We have a real shortage of foster carers. We need people like you be brave and take the step to make a call and find out more. You don’t need to be perfect - you just need to care.

At any one time there are 30 children and young people in Cornwall who need a place to call home. You could be: 

  • single
  • live in a flat
  • rent where you live
  • be LGBTQ+

All you need to be a fosterer, is:

  • be able to provide a place of comfort and stability to help a child realise their potential
  • have your own place to live (rented or owned)
  • be over 21
